Overview

Henri Nouwen was one of the most significant spiritual leaders of our time. During his life, Nouwen served as priest, academic, psychologist, teacher, and author. This collection reflects his diverse set of roles and communicates his earnest desire to seek the Lord. Nouwen reflects on topics including prayer, solitude, spiritual journeys, sanctification, and death.

About Henri J. M. Nouwen

Henri J. M. Nouwen is one of the most popular spiritual writers of our time. He wrote more than forty books, among them the bestselling Out of Solitude. He taught at the University of Notre Dame, as well as Yale and Harvard Universities. From 1986 until his death in 1996, he was part of the L’Arche Daybreak community in Toronto, where he shared his life with people with mental disabilities.
